Mostly Lurkin Posted January 10, 2007 Share Posted January 10, 2007 I buy a M&P base from www.thegourmetrose.com in the honey. I make a Oatmeal Honey soap that everyone adores.2lbs Honey M&P1 cup ground oatmeal1/4 cup honey1 TBS natural Vitamin E1-2 ozs Frankincense&Myhrr FO.5 oz vanilla (non-darkening FO)Melt the soap, remove from heat - add all, stir til it gets gloppy (I'm real technical eh?) pour into molds. Viola - smells good enough to eat and feels FAB.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
